Glance View
Siemens Energy India Ltd. engages in the provision of solutions in the energy value chain, which are power and heat generation, transmission to storage through a portfolio that includes conventional and renewable energy technology such as gas and steam turbines, hybrid power plants operated with hydrogen as well as power generators and transformers. The company is head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ra. The company went IPO on 2025-06-19. The firm offers a range of products, solutions and services covering a large part of the energy value chain. Its customer base includes oil and gas, power utilities, IPPs, EPCs, transmission system operators, data centers and industrial companies in sectors such as cement, metals, sugar and ethanol, paper & pulp, and petrochemicals. The Company’s segments include Power Generation and Power Transmission. The Generation Segment focuses on business and related services, such as large and industrial gas turbines, large and industrial steam turbines, energy efficiency solutions such as waste heat recovery, and others. The Transmission segment focuses on manufacturing and supplying HV and EHV equipment like air insulated (AIS) and gas insulated (GIS) switchgears, power transformers, bushing, instrument transformers and coils and related accessories.
